ITD asks employees to use
masks and social distancing
to enhance safety

To help prevent the spread of the covid-19 virus, the Idaho Transportation Department asks employees to use masks to cover their faces and social distancing. The best guidance on this is from the Centers for Disease Control (CDC).

·  CDC: Use of Cloth Face Coverings to Help Slow the Spread of COVID-19

The CDC has recommended the use of face coverings to help slow the spread of COVID-19. ITD has made masks available to all employees. Workers should speak with their supervisor or supply personnel for information on how coverings can be obtained.

Face coverings should be worn whenever people are in a community setting, and especially anytime social distancing cannot be maintained, such as:

- When riding in vehicles together.
- When in close proximity to others indoors, working or otherwise.
- When in close proximity to others outdoors, working or otherwise.

Face coverings must be washed before initial use and then every day after use.

It is important that employees understand that the use of face coverings does not protect individuals from contracting COVID-19, but rather helps prevent possible transmission to others. It is also important to note that social distancing should still be maintained, where possible, regardless of whether face coverings are utilized.

"When working alone or out in the field, where social distancing is possible, face covers are probably not necessary. But when riding in vehicles or working close together the covers are there to reduce the chance of infecting each other," ITD Safety Manager Randy Danner said. "We hope employees will choose to wear the face covers just because it is the right thing to do."
